Universities Should Also Pay Taxes To Increase Awareness

[Unpad.ac.id, 10/11/2016] Universities should be involved in promoting awareness of paying taxes in the community. This involvement must be one of the college’s commitments to contribute to the nation.

Rector Universitas Padjadjaran, Prof. Tri Hanggono Achmad said, there are two aspects of the strength of universities in raising awareness of paying taxes. The two aspects, namely the power of knowledge and networking cooperation with third parties. It is proposed by Rector during the opening Socialization State Tax Amnesty and Tax Law Firm in Bale Sawala Jatinangor Unpad Campus, Thursday (10/11).

To the participants consisting of university leaders and faculty, Head of Section and Sub-Section Unpad Rector explained that it is not an optimal improvement of the tax led to the government’s budget always in deficit. Though the tax sector is the mainstay of the state budget financing.

“As a college that has the academic strength, especially now State University as Legal Entity, we should have a strong awareness to encourage this, starting from us,” said Rector.

The diversity of the scientific potential possessed allowed Unpad to conduct research related to taxes. According to the Rector, tax-related research has a greater scope in non-financial sector. “In addition to the financial sector, is greater in non-micro aspects; legal aspects, behavioral aspects, social aspects, to the cultural aspect. We must give assistance. Almost nothing in science we are not related,” he explained.

humas-unpad-2016_11_10-amnesti-pajak-1-dadanWith contributions through the academic sector, the rector believes that this should be a differentiator with other institutions. This contribution is expected to be a commitment also for other universities in an effort to increase state revenues from the taxation sector.

In addition, Unpad can also contribute by encouraging collaboration through networking. Currently, through the program Nyaah ka Jabar Padjadjaran, Unpad at least have networks of cooperation with 27 City/Regency in West Java. These two aspects are expected to build up the confidence to push the expansion of the spirit of paying taxes.

Furthermore, the Rector said that the success of the tax paying public capital is to accelerate development in Indonesia. He is optimistic that the public welfare will rise. If the income the greater the impact on the increase of infrastructure services, health services, to improve welfare.

“This is what we have to realize,” said Rector.
